Precipitation separation as metal hydroxides is possible! The decomposition process of residual hydrogen peroxide is unnecessary.
One of the wastewater treatment methods is the Fenton treatment process, which is commonly used in a systematized form. By adding a special catalyst called "Kotalist PB," the treatment efficiency can be significantly improved. It is now possible to decompose difficult-to-degrade COD and TOC that were previously challenging. Since the amount of iron salt (FeSO4·7H2O) used can be reduced, the resulting sludge is greatly minimized. 【Advantages】 ■ Capable of decomposing difficult-to-degrade COD and TOC ■ Precipitation separation as metal hydroxides is possible ■ Decomposition rate is significantly improved compared to conventional Fenton treatment ■ No need for a decomposition process for residual hydrogen peroxide ■ Can be used with only minor modifications to existing equipment *For more details, please refer to the PDF document or feel free to contact us.
